Step 1: Understanding the National Anthem of India.
The national anthem of India is "Jana Gana Mana". Step 2: Identifying the Writer.
Rabindranath Tagore, a renowned poet, composed the national anthem. It was first sung in 1911 at the Calcutta Session of the Indian National Congress. Step 3: Verifying the Options.
